DEL CASTILLO OCHOA, Sandra et al. Identificación fitoquímica de las hojas y ramas de la Helietta cubensis Monach-Moldenke, especie endémica de Cuba. Rev Cubana Farm [online]. 2004, vol.38, n.1, pp. 0-0. ISSN 1561-2988.

The preliminary phytochemical screening of the leaves and branches of Helietta cubensis Monach-Moldenke, a Cuban endemic species that grows in the hummocks of Pinar del Río is described. The detection of the secondary metabolites was carried out by reagents of identification that are specific for each family of compounds. A great number of flavonoids and lactones/coumarines was identified in both parts of the species. A low concentration of triterpenes/steroids, lipids/essential oils, saponins and carotenes was observed, whereas amines and alkaloids were not detected. The results obtained in the identification of alkaloids, flavonoids and coumarines were corroborated by thin layer chromatography. In general, the results attained were homogeneous for both parts of the plant and they are the first report about the chemical composition of this species.
